Etymology

The origin of the region's name to believed to have been derived from William Bet, an 17th century Alstinian explorer who surveyed much of the region beyond its coastline. As the region began to be settled, it initially known as William Bet's Lands, before being shortened with the passage of time to its current denomination.

Geography

The Betlands is a vast region bounded by the Porlosi Gap to the north, the Pankaran Plateau to the northeast, the Gamboa River to the east, and the Sea of Orixtal to the south and west. As a result, the region encompasses a wide range of climates, from the humid Mediterranean and subtropical climates of the coast, to the humid contintental climate of the southern interior, to the arid mountainous and highland of the Velyrian Uplands and the Panakra Plateau respectively.

The topography of the Betlands has been described as being akin to a "bent horseshoe" or a "cracked egg", as the defining feature in the central portion of the Betlands, a mountainous region known as the Velyrian Uplands, is nearly surrounded by the fertile expanse of the Bettish Plains, with the Pankaran Plateau connecting with the Velyrian Uplands from the north. Additionally, the region is inundated with rivers, many of which that separately flow into the Orixtal from sources in the Velyrian Uplands, the Pankaran Plateau and the Discosian Range. This multitude of rivers, collectively known as the Bettish Watershed system, combined with favorable climatic conditions and the ease of traversal on most these waterways, have contributed to the Betlands' reputation as one of the most abundantly fertile regions in Crona, as well as concentrating much the Bettish population across the coast and along the rivers.

Economy

The Betlands have long been an agricultural powerhouse, accounting for 39% of all Alstinian agricultural output in 2030, with particular dominance in the domestic growing of corn, wheat, rye and coffee; This in turn has garnered the Betlands with the reputation of being the "Breadbasket of the Republic". In addition, the region is also a major producer of vegatables, bananas, oranges, sunflowers, cotton, tobacco, and indigo, with much of what is grown exported to either the Alstinian Isles or other countries in southern Crona, such as Asteria, Pankara, Porlos and Tierrador.

Aside from agriculture, the Betlands has a strong mining industry located predominantly in the Velyrian Uplands and the Pankaran Plateau, a significant fishing and shipbuilding industry along its northwestern coastline, and a robust manufacturing and transportation sectors across Bettish Plains. Moreover, the service-oriented sectors are among the fastest growing in the region, with tourism, retail trade, insurance, banking and financial services spearheading much of the growth both in this sector, and the provincial economy as a whole.

Culture

The basis for much of Bettish culture derives from its roots the various settler Colonies, and from much of the population of the colonial Betlands having ancestral links to colonists who emigrated east; Specifically by large groups of people from parts of southern Alstin such as Rocotia, Daltonland, and Bryceland who moved to the western coast the late 17th and early 18th centuries, Kjeldorians and Sierrians who settled in Velyrian Uplands and the Pankaran Plateau in the early to mid 18th century, and the many Audonian people who were brought to the Betlands as slaves during the 17th century. Their descendants, identified as Black or Audonian-Alstinians, compose the United Republic's second-largest racial minority, accounting for 21.3%) of the total population according to the 2020 census.

The Betlands has had a significant of its population adhering to evangelical Protestantism ever since the 1860s, although the majority of Bettish have often stayed Chantric. While Protestants are the most common religious group, Catholics have had a significant presence in the province, historically concentrating in Sedem Regni, Ithacios, and other areas near the Porlosi border and along the Beclian Coast.
